Abstract
1,058,598. Automatic feed weighers. PELZ & NAGEL G.m.b.H. Aug. 15, 1963 [Aug. 16, 1962], No.32232/63. Heading G1W. An automatic weigher has a means to prevent oscillation of its lever system due to impact of material on a scale pan which would be transmitted as apparent weight to an indicator, and has means controlled by the indicator to provide main and dribble feeds. GENERAL - To prevent oscillation the lever system 3, 6 (Fig. 1), is engageable with two stops one of which (a spring-loaded bell crank lever 8) is operative to support the levers 6, 3 in a position approximately corresponding to that when the required amount of material has been supplied in the main feed, thereby preventing movement of the lever system in the direction of load relief, and the other stop (an electromagnet 11 operating a locking lever 12) is operative to prevent the lever system moving in the direction due to the load and is releasable when the feed is reduced to a dribble feed. A damping device 15 is also provided and is arranged to provide a powerful damping effect at the beginning of the lever system movement and only a slight damping effect in the region of the final position of an indicating pointer 5'. OPERATION - An electrical contact 10 is positioned on a calibrated scale 5" at a predetermined value, below the target weight, so that when the material fed to a scale pan (not shown) attains that value the pointer 5' co-operates with the contact 10 and the main feed is switched off and the dribble feed commences. The switch simultaneously energizes the electromagnet 11 which moves the locking lever 12 so as to prevent movement of the lever 6 in the direction due to the load. As the lever 6 moves up toward the locking lever 12 and its equilibrium position, a spring 8' rotates the bell crank lever 8 against a permanent magnet 13 which holds it and prevents the lever system swinging back to its old position. (The strength of the magnet is such that it will release the locking lever 8 when the lever 6 moves downward against it as the scale pan is being emptied). After the lever system has been locked the locking of its upward movement by the magnet 11 is released, following an interval determined by a time switch (not shown); since the impact loading due to the main feed has now ceased. The dribble feed is switched off when the pointer 5' reaches a contact 14 on the scale 5". The scale pan is then emptied by means not described. LEVER SYSTEM - The lever system includes a tare lever 3, with an adjustable counter-weight 9, and connected to a lever, supporting a scale pan, by a pull rod 2. The lever 3 is rigidly connected through links to bolts 3', 3" which support a load counter-balancing lever 6 having a slidable counter-weight 7. When adjusting the zero of the indicator to allow for tare the lever 6 can be lifted off the bolts by an electromagnet 22. After a preselected number of weighings the tare can be adjusted automatically by a motor (19) Fig. 2 (not shown), co-operative with a chain (20). The indicator pointer is coupled to the lever system by a steel tape 4.
